. ABSTRACT Neuroinflammation driven by microglial activation is a defining feature of Alzheimer's disease (AD), yet the molecular mechanisms sustaining this proinflammatory state remain unclear. Here, we identify the deubiquitinase OTUD7B as a critical regulator of microglial activation and AD pathology.

Mitochondrial SLC25A46 is upregulated in ovarian cancer (OC) and correlates with poor prognosis. SLC25A46 stabilizes CACT to activate fatty acid oxidation, increasing ATP and NADPH production to drive cell proliferation and ferroptosis evasion.
